What You’ll Learn
Notification of Changes – F580, is a top 10 deficiency in the nation according to the Quality Certification and Oversite Reports (QCOR)’s survey deficiency citations of 2021. Deficiencies frequently cited for F580 identify the need for notification to the resident, resident representative and the physician when there are changes in treatment, accidents that have occurred or when there is significant change is their condition, as indicated. This session discusses the current regulation, how to identify a significant change in condition on the MDS and the needed revisions to the care plan. Are you adequately communicating pertinent changes to necessary team members? What processes do you have in place and are they enough?
After attending this webinar, attendees will be able to:
- Review the notification requirements of F580
- Discuss Significant Change rules according to the RAI manual and care plan revisions
- Identify areas of the RAI process that could lead to citations related F580
